2012 emerging artist nominee set to play Sunset Theatre

Adrian Glynn will once again take centre stage at Sunset Theatre Aug. 22

Last summer, acclaimed modern roots music act, The Fugitives, sold out their one night only performance at The Sunset Theatre in Wells.

On Aug. 22 at 8 p.m., one of The Fugitives most beloved members, Adrian Glynn, will once again take centre stage at The Sunset for an evening of his acclaimed solo work.

Adrian Glynn is an accomplished singer/songwriter, musician, actor and burgeoning travel writer. He recently released his first full-length record, Bruise, to much national acclaim.

“On Bruise, Glynn shows his incredible lyrical skills, wedged somewhere between the storytelling whimsy of Iron and Wine’s Sam Beam and the honesty of Josh Ritter” (Vancouver Sun).

Bruise also netted Glynn a nomination for Emerging Artist of the Year at the 2012 Canadian Independent Music Awards, and in 2009, he was a finalist in a province-wide music competition, the Peak Performance Project, after completing his first (self-titled) recording with producer Dave Genn of 54-40.
